The regulatory treatment of blockchain gaming varies dramatically across jurisdictions, creating a complex compliance matrix for global platforms. Major markets have developed distinct approaches reflecting different priorities around consumer protection, innovation, and financial stability.

Key Concept

United States: Fragmented Federal and State Oversight

The US regulatory landscape for blockchain gaming operates across multiple federal agencies and 50 state jurisdictions, creating significant compliance complexity. The Securities and Exchange Commission (SEC) applies securities laws to gaming tokens, while the Commodity Futures Trading Commission (CFTC) may assert jurisdiction over certain gaming derivatives. State gambling commissions regulate chance-based mechanics, and the Treasury Department's Financial Crimes Enforcement Network (FinCEN) applies anti-money laundering requirements.

As established in Securities Law & Digital Assets, Lesson 12, gaming tokens face securities analysis under the Howey test. Tokens distributed through play-to-earn mechanics generally avoid securities classification when players receive them through skill-based gameplay rather than investment. However, tokens sold in initial offerings, distributed to passive stakers, or providing governance rights over protocol economics frequently trigger securities requirements.

The state-level gambling analysis proves particularly challenging. Traditional gambling requires three elements: consideration (payment), chance (random outcome), and prize (something of value). Many play-to-earn games incorporate all three elements, potentially triggering gambling regulations in states where they operate. The skill versus chance analysis becomes critical -- games where player skill predominantly determines outcomes may avoid gambling classification even with chance elements.

European Union: GDPR and MiCA Convergence

The European Union approaches blockchain gaming through the lens of data protection, financial regulation, and consumer rights. The General Data Protection Regulation (GDPR) significantly impacts gaming platforms that process player data, requiring explicit consent for data collection, providing data portability rights, and implementing privacy-by-design principles.

The Markets in Crypto-Assets (MiCA) regulation, fully effective January 2025, classifies gaming tokens as crypto-assets subject to authorization requirements for issuers and service providers. Gaming platforms operating across EU member states must obtain MiCA licenses, implement investor protection measures, and maintain regulatory capital requirements.

Asia-Pacific: Innovation Hubs and Strict Controls

Asian markets present the greatest regulatory diversity for blockchain gaming. Singapore's Monetary Authority has created regulatory sandboxes allowing gaming platforms to test innovative models with temporary relief from certain requirements. The Payment Services Act provides clarity for gaming token custody and exchange services, while maintaining strict anti-money laundering requirements.

Japan's approach focuses on consumer protection through the Financial Services Agency's crypto-asset regulations. Gaming tokens traded on exchanges require registration as crypto-assets, while in-game utility tokens may operate under payment service provider frameworks. The Japan Virtual Currency Exchange Association provides self-regulatory guidelines specifically addressing gaming applications.

China maintains comprehensive prohibitions on cryptocurrency activities, effectively banning blockchain gaming that involves crypto-asset trading or speculation. However, Chinese gaming companies continue developing blockchain gaming for international markets, creating a significant export industry operating under foreign regulatory frameworks.

South Korea permits blockchain gaming under specific conditions through the Game Rating and Administration Committee. Games must clearly distinguish between gameplay rewards and speculative trading, implement robust age verification systems, and comply with the Special Act on Game Industry Promotion.

Key Concept

Emerging Market Approaches

Developing markets increasingly view blockchain gaming as economic development opportunities while implementing consumer protection measures. The Philippines' Bangko Sentral ng Pilipinas has created specific guidelines for play-to-earn platforms following the Axie Infinity phenomenon, requiring operator registration and player protection measures.

Brazil's Central Bank includes gaming tokens under its crypto-asset regulations, requiring platforms to register as virtual asset service providers. Mexico's gaming commission has proposed comprehensive blockchain gaming regulations expected to take effect in late 2026.

The application of securities laws to gaming tokens represents one of the most significant regulatory challenges facing blockchain gaming platforms. The analysis requires careful examination of token distribution mechanisms, holder rights, and economic expectations.

Key Concept

The Howey Test in Gaming Context

Gaming tokens face securities analysis under the four-prong Howey test: investment of money, common enterprise, expectation of profits, and profits derived from efforts of others. Each element requires specific analysis in gaming contexts.

The "investment of money" prong typically applies when players purchase tokens directly from developers or through initial offerings. However, tokens earned through gameplay generally don't constitute investments, as players provide skill and time rather than money. The analysis becomes complex when players purchase in-game items or battle passes that provide token-earning opportunities.

"Common enterprise" exists when token holders' fortunes are tied together through shared protocol economics. Gaming platforms with shared token economies, where all players benefit from overall platform success, typically establish common enterprise. Individual game instances with isolated token economies may avoid this requirement.

"Expectation of profits" focuses on purchaser motivations rather than actual outcomes. Gaming tokens marketed for their investment potential, price appreciation prospects, or passive income generation clearly trigger this prong. Tokens marketed purely for gameplay utility may avoid securities classification, but secondary market trading often creates profit expectations regardless of initial marketing.

"Profits from efforts of others" examines whether token value depends on developer actions rather than holder efforts. Gaming tokens requiring ongoing developer support, content creation, or platform maintenance typically satisfy this prong. Fully decentralized gaming protocols with autonomous operation may avoid securities classification.

Governance Token Considerations

Gaming platforms increasingly issue governance tokens providing voting rights over protocol parameters, economic models, and development priorities. These tokens face heightened securities scrutiny due to their explicit connection to platform management and economic outcomes.

The SEC's 2023 guidance on decentralized autonomous organizations applies directly to gaming governance tokens. Tokens providing meaningful control over platform economics, development direction, or revenue distribution typically qualify as securities regardless of their gaming utility.

Governance token distribution mechanisms significantly impact securities analysis. Tokens distributed through airdrops to active players may avoid securities classification, while tokens sold in fundraising rounds clearly constitute securities offerings. Gradual distribution through gameplay achievements creates intermediate cases requiring careful legal analysis.

Key Concept

Utility Token Safe Harbors

Gaming tokens can potentially avoid securities classification by establishing clear utility functions and limiting investment characteristics. Successful utility token strategies focus on consumption-based economics rather than investment-oriented distribution.

Tokens used exclusively for in-game purchases, character upgrades, or gameplay mechanics typically qualify as utility tokens when distributed through gameplay rather than investment. The key requirement is ensuring tokens serve genuine utility functions rather than speculative trading purposes.

The timing of utility availability proves critical. Tokens distributed before their utility functions are available typically face securities analysis, while tokens distributed simultaneously with utility availability may avoid securities classification. Gaming platforms must carefully coordinate token distribution with feature deployment.

Secondary Market Securities Risk

Even utility tokens can become securities through secondary market trading dynamics. Gaming tokens that develop active trading markets, price speculation, or investment-oriented marketing may retroactively trigger securities requirements. Platforms must monitor secondary market activity and implement appropriate controls to maintain utility token status.

The intersection of gambling laws with blockchain gaming mechanics creates significant compliance challenges, particularly for games incorporating random elements, paid participation, or valuable rewards. Traditional gambling regulations were designed for casinos and lotteries, but their broad definitions often encompass modern gaming mechanics.

Key Concept

The Three-Element Gambling Test

Gambling laws across most jurisdictions require three elements: consideration, chance, and prize. Each element requires specific analysis in gaming contexts, and platforms must carefully design mechanics to avoid triggering all three simultaneously.

Consideration encompasses any payment, whether monetary or valuable, required for participation. Direct token purchases clearly constitute consideration, but the analysis extends to time investment, in-game asset consumption, or opportunity costs. Some jurisdictions recognize "time and effort" as consideration, significantly broadening gambling law applications.

The chance element examines whether outcomes depend on random events rather than player skill. Pure chance games like slot machines clearly trigger gambling laws, while pure skill games like chess typically avoid them. Most gaming mechanics incorporate mixed skill and chance elements, requiring careful legal analysis of the predominant factor.

Prize analysis focuses on whether players can receive something of value through gameplay. Monetary prizes clearly qualify, but the definition extends to any item with economic value, including gaming tokens, NFTs, or in-game assets with secondary markets. Even items without direct monetary value may constitute prizes if they provide competitive advantages or social status.

Key Concept

Skill Versus Chance Analysis

The skill versus chance determination proves critical for gaming platforms seeking to avoid gambling classification. Courts apply various tests to evaluate the relative importance of skill and chance in determining outcomes.

Legal Tests for Skill vs Chance

Dominant Factor Test
  • Examines whether skill or chance primarily determines outcomes
  • Games where skilled players consistently outperform qualify as skill-based
  • Must consider entire gameplay experience, not just individual mechanics
Any Chance Test
  • Classifies any game with meaningful chance elements as gambling
  • Strict standard that significantly limits compliant gaming design
  • Applied in some jurisdictions regardless of skill requirements
Material Element Test
  • Focuses on whether chance plays meaningful role in outcomes
  • Allows skill-based games with minor chance elements
  • Restricts games where chance significantly impacts results

Deep Insight: The Esports Precedent Professional esports provides important precedent for skill-based gaming classification. Games like League of Legends, Dota 2, and Counter-Strike incorporate random elements (critical hit chances, item drops, spawn locations) but maintain skill-based classification due to professional competition structures and consistent skill-based outcomes. Gaming platforms can leverage similar arguments by demonstrating skill-based competitive ladders and consistent performance differentials between skilled and novice players.

Key Concept

Loot Box and Gacha Regulations

Loot boxes and gacha mechanics face increasing regulatory scrutiny as potential gambling activities. These systems allow players to purchase randomized rewards, creating clear consideration and chance elements with potentially valuable prizes.

Belgium's Gaming Commission classified certain loot boxes as gambling in 2018, requiring operators to obtain gambling licenses or remove the mechanics. The Netherlands followed similar approaches, while the UK Gambling Commission initially declined to regulate loot boxes but continues monitoring developments.

China requires disclosure of loot box probabilities and implements spending limits for minors. Japan's Consumer Affairs Agency regulates gacha mechanics under consumer protection laws, prohibiting "complete gacha" systems that require collecting full sets for valuable rewards.

  • Probability disclosure provides transparency about reward chances
  • Spending limits prevent excessive expenditures
  • Direct purchase options may avoid gambling classification
  • Earned currency systems can maintain monetization while reducing risk
Key Concept

Age Verification and Minor Protection

Gambling laws typically prohibit minor participation, creating age verification requirements for gaming platforms with gambling-adjacent mechanics. These requirements extend beyond traditional age gates to robust identity verification systems.

The Children's Online Privacy Protection Act (COPPA) in the US requires parental consent for collecting personal information from children under 13. Gaming platforms implementing age verification must balance compliance requirements with privacy protection and user experience optimization.

European GDPR creates additional complexity for age verification, requiring explicit consent mechanisms and data minimization principles. Gaming platforms must implement privacy-by-design age verification systems that collect minimal personal information while ensuring compliance.

Blockchain-based identity solutions offer potential improvements for gaming age verification. Decentralized identity systems can provide age attestation without revealing specific birth dates or personal information, but regulatory acceptance of these systems remains limited.

The taxation of play-to-earn gaming income creates significant compliance obligations for both platforms and players. Tax authorities increasingly treat gaming rewards as taxable income, requiring careful reporting and withholding procedures.

Key Concept

Income Recognition for Gaming Rewards

Gaming rewards typically constitute ordinary income upon receipt, valued at fair market value on the receipt date. This treatment applies to tokens, NFTs, in-game assets, and other valuable items received through gameplay, regardless of whether players immediately convert them to fiat currency.

The timing of income recognition depends on when players gain control over rewards. Tokens credited to player wallets typically trigger immediate income recognition, while tokens subject to vesting schedules or gameplay requirements may defer recognition until restrictions lapse.

Valuation of gaming rewards requires establishing fair market value on receipt dates. Tokens with active trading markets use market prices, while unique NFTs or in-game assets require appraisal methods. Platforms can assist players by providing valuation data, but players remain responsible for accurate reporting.

As explored in XRP Tax Guide, Lesson 8, gaming income reporting requires careful documentation of receipt dates, fair market values, and subsequent disposition activities. Players must maintain detailed records for each gaming session, token receipt, and asset transfer.

Key Concept

Capital Gains Treatment for Asset Sales

Gaming assets held as investments may qualify for capital gains treatment upon sale, potentially providing more favorable tax rates than ordinary income. However, the analysis requires demonstrating investment intent rather than business activity.

The holding period determines whether gains qualify as short-term (ordinary rates) or long-term (preferential rates) capital gains. Gaming tokens and NFTs must be held for more than one year to qualify for long-term treatment in most jurisdictions.

The basis calculation for gaming assets begins with the fair market value upon receipt (already taxed as ordinary income) plus any acquisition costs. Subsequent sales generate capital gains or losses based on the difference between sale proceeds and adjusted basis.

Gaming platforms can facilitate capital gains reporting by providing transaction histories, basis tracking, and gain/loss calculations. However, players remain responsible for accurate reporting and should consult tax professionals for complex situations.

Key Concept

International Tax Considerations

Cross-border gaming creates complex international tax obligations, particularly for platforms with global player bases or developers in multiple jurisdictions. Players may face tax obligations in their residence countries, platform operation countries, or both.

Tax treaties between countries may provide relief from double taxation, but players must understand applicable provisions and filing requirements. The US-UK tax treaty, for example, generally allows gaming income taxation only in the player's residence country, but specific circumstances may trigger source-country taxation.

Gaming platforms may face withholding obligations for non-resident players, particularly for large reward distributions or professional gaming activities. These requirements vary significantly by jurisdiction and require careful legal analysis.

Key Concept

Platform Reporting Obligations

Gaming platforms increasingly face information reporting requirements similar to traditional financial institutions. The US requires Form 1099 reporting for payments exceeding $600 annually, while other jurisdictions implement similar thresholds.

The Infrastructure Investment and Jobs Act of 2021 expanded broker reporting requirements to include digital asset transactions, potentially covering gaming platform activities. Platforms facilitating player-to-player asset transfers or operating secondary markets may qualify as brokers subject to reporting obligations.

International reporting requirements continue evolving, with the OECD's Crypto-Asset Reporting Framework expected to require gaming platform participation in automatic information exchange programs. These requirements will significantly increase compliance costs and operational complexity for global platforms.

Creating gaming economic models that navigate regulatory requirements while maintaining engaging gameplay requires careful balance between compliance obligations and user experience optimization. Successful approaches integrate regulatory considerations into core game design rather than treating compliance as an afterthought.

Key Concept

Regulatory-First Game Design

Regulatory-first design begins with comprehensive legal analysis of target markets, identifying specific requirements and restrictions before developing game mechanics. This approach prevents costly redesigns and regulatory violations while enabling global market access.

Design Process Steps

1
Jurisdiction mapping

Identify where players, developers, and platform operators are located

2
Requirement documentation

Document specific securities, gambling, tax, and privacy requirements for each jurisdiction

3
Mechanic analysis

Examine each proposed game feature for regulatory implications

4
Compliance-by-design implementation

Embed regulatory requirements into core system architecture

Compliance-by-design principles embed regulatory requirements into core system architecture rather than adding compliance features later. Age verification systems integrate with wallet creation, transaction monitoring builds into payment systems, and reporting functions connect to all value transfer mechanisms.

Key Concept

Token Economic Compliance Models

Gaming token economics must balance engaging gameplay with regulatory compliance across multiple jurisdictions. Successful models implement utility-focused designs that minimize securities and gambling law risks while maintaining player engagement.

Consumption-based token economics encourage spending rather than accumulation, reducing securities law risks while creating sustainable revenue models. Tokens serve as in-game currency for purchases, upgrades, and services rather than investment vehicles. Regular token burning or expiration mechanisms prevent accumulation and speculation.

Earned distribution models provide tokens through skill-based gameplay rather than monetary investment. Players receive tokens for achievements, competition victories, or time-based rewards rather than purchasing them directly. This approach typically avoids securities classification while maintaining player motivation.

Utility-first token design ensures tokens serve genuine gameplay functions rather than speculative purposes. Successful implementations include crafting materials, experience boosters, cosmetic items, and access passes that provide clear value within the gaming ecosystem.

Key Concept

Privacy-Compliant Player Systems

Gaming platforms must implement privacy-compliant player systems that balance regulatory requirements with user experience and data protection obligations. These systems must address age verification, anti-money laundering, and data protection requirements simultaneously.

Decentralized identity solutions offer potential improvements for gaming privacy compliance. Self-sovereign identity systems can provide age attestation, jurisdiction verification, and compliance status without revealing unnecessary personal information. However, regulatory acceptance of these systems remains limited and requires ongoing monitoring.

Data minimization principles require collecting only information necessary for specific compliance purposes. Age verification systems should confirm age ranges rather than specific birth dates, while jurisdiction verification can use general location data rather than precise addresses. These approaches reduce privacy risks while maintaining compliance.

Progressive disclosure models reveal player information only when required for specific activities. Basic gameplay may require minimal information, while high-value transactions or competitive participation may trigger additional verification requirements. This approach balances user experience with compliance obligations.

Compliance Complexity Scaling

Gaming platform compliance complexity scales exponentially with geographic reach and feature sophistication. A simple single-jurisdiction game with basic mechanics may require minimal compliance infrastructure, while a global platform with complex token economics, governance features, and social elements may require millions of dollars in annual compliance costs. Platforms must carefully evaluate the cost-benefit analysis of additional features and markets.

Key Concept

Cross-Border Compliance Strategies

Global gaming platforms must develop comprehensive cross-border compliance strategies that address varying requirements across multiple jurisdictions while maintaining operational efficiency. These strategies require careful balance between local compliance and global scalability.

Jurisdiction-specific feature sets allow platforms to customize functionality based on local requirements. Players in restrictive jurisdictions may access limited features, while those in permissive markets can utilize full platform capabilities. This approach requires sophisticated geolocation and access control systems.

Regulatory sandbox participation provides opportunities to test innovative models with temporary regulatory relief. Singapore, the UK, and several US states offer gaming-specific sandbox programs that allow platforms to experiment with new models while working closely with regulators.

Professional compliance partnerships enable gaming platforms to access specialized expertise without building internal capabilities. Law firms, compliance consultants, and regulatory technology providers offer services specifically designed for blockchain gaming platforms, often at lower costs than internal development.
